1. Human and administrative prerequisites
First of all, it is better to collect some personal documents: licence B held for at least 3 years (or 2 years in case of accompanied driving), criminal record blank (bulletin no. 2), medical certificate of fitness issued by a registered doctor and recent certificate PSC1 (less than 2 years). This step often seems obvious, however, in practice it sometimes blocks the most motivated profiles: it is better to anticipate first aid training. A trainer also mentioned the case of a candidate who had waited several months to get a seat in a small town: do not put it back to the last minute.
Figures to keep in mind: the medical certificate is invoiced between40 and 80 €; PSC1 certification costs about50 €and usually takes place over a day.
2. Pass training and taxi examination agreed upon
The initial training usually lasts50 to 300 hours, depending on your profile and your department, for a cost ranging from400 € 3 000 €. It is then necessary to pass the examination of the Certificate of Professional Capacity taxi (CCPCT), including a theoretical test and a practical setting. This is not always obvious, as local regulation is sometimes complex and driving is scrutinized in terms of safety and sense of service. Furthermore, training centres regularly offer modules specific to medical transport, so do not hesitate to take advantage of them.
Finally: plan195 €for exam registration, and block about 20 days to prepare and review effectively.
3. Get professional card and ADS (Parking Authorization)
After the examination, it is better to obtain the professional card (60 €valid5 years), then obtain a Parking Authorization (ADS) from the town hall or prefecture. In the city, holding a license can become a delicate step: in Paris or Nice, its price sometimes reaches300 000 € purchaseor3,500 €/month for rent. In smaller municipalities, access is at times free, or much less complex.
| City | Purchase ADS License | Rental ADS License |
|---|---|---|
| Paris | 190 000 € | 3,500 €/month |
| Nice | 250 000 € | not communicated |
| Province | Free at 30,000 € | Varies according to the municipality |
On the human level, many taxis in Paris start with renting: it is therefore better to anticipate this expenditure according to the strategy chosen.
4. SPAC agreement file: the gateway to the medical market
After obtaining the professional card and the ADS, it is better to prepare his contract file with the CPAM of the department. At that time, every detail counts: bank identity statement, updated USSRAF certificate, copy of the grey card, professional card and commitment document on the medical transport charter. Depending on the region, treatment takes place2 to 4 weeks(some candidates share this deadline on specialised forums).
A health care professional recommends preparing a complete file as soon as the license is obtained: a paper or digital checklist reassures and avoids many omissions.
5. Vehicle compliance: safety, equipment, controls
In order to provide the service by taxi, the vehicle must meet a number of criteria: maximum capacity of 9 seats, certified taximeter, CB terminal, compliant taxi marking, and prescribed medical kit. The technical inspection must be renewed every year from the second year, while installation of equipment usually costs between1 000 € and 2,500 €, depending on the model.
For example, some professionals inadvertently neglected the annual vehicle check and found themselves in a stalemate at a time of high demand. In concrete terms, it is better not to have to refuse an important race for a question of conformity control...
6. Convention signature and start-up
After validation of all the steps, the signing of the agreement with the CPAM allows to practice in the transport of patients cared for. The Convention extends5 years, renewable from October 2025: this document remains valuable since it guarantees a regular and stable clientele (the average monthly income is around1,700 to 2,000 € Net).

Taxi agreement, VSL, craftsman or employee: what practical differences?
The world of health transport consists mainly of several statutes: taxi, VSL (Vehicle Sanitary Light), craftsman or employee. Making the right choice means anticipating the specifics of the business regime and the expected profitability.
Comparison of status and income
| Status | Access | Equipment | Monthly net income |
|---|---|---|---|
| Chartered Taxi | ADS license + SPAM convention | Taximeter, CB, medical kit | 1 700 € 2 000 € |
| VSL | Employment, ARS agreement | Blue banner, sanitary equipment | 1,400 € at 1 800 € |
| Uncontracted Taxi | ADS License | Same equipment, no SPAC support | Variable (depending on customers) |
It is noted that the agreement ensures stability, patient care and visibility on the volume of medical races. What many appreciate is this promise of regular customers and the security of the SPAM payment.

What are the average deadlines for obtaining the agreement?
There is usually rarely less4 weeks, sometimes8 weeksin the case of incomplete files or high demand. In some departments, a time frame is published online: this suggests that it is appropriate to check this information before planning the start date.
Continuous training and renewal: how does it work?
The professional card is renewed all the5 years, with compulsory continuing education (a recipe for2-35 p.m.). CPAM controls and audits are intensified as the reform of October 2025 approaches. Several former entrepreneurs have learned at their expense: it is better to anticipate training than to wait for the last minute.
What penalties are imposed for non-compliance or administrative delay?
Annual technical checks are essential and, like the updating of the USSRAF and the SPAC Convention, should not be postponed. To delay or neglect a renewal is liable to suspension of the agreement or even tofines. Pay attention to these deadlines, especially in large cities where competition is strong!
Legal update: what changes in 2025
The new medical taxi convention will come into force in October 2025 – with increased requirements: enhanced transparency on billing, electronic signature requirements for each race, periodic monitoring of on-board equipment. A management trainer strongly recommends: check that the software used will be compatible, otherwise they will have to update everything in the coming year.
